Overview

ALK Alutard 5-grasses is a standardized allergen extract used for subcutaneous immunotherapy (SCIT) in patients with moderate to severe IgE-mediated allergic rhinoconjunctivitis caused by grass pollen. The product contains a mixture of allergenic extracts from five temperate grasses—Timothy (Phleum pratense), Orchard (Dactylis glomerata), June (Poa pratensis), Redtop (Agrostis alba), and Sweet Vernal (Anthoxanthum odoratum)—adsorbed onto aluminum hydroxide as an adjuvant. The mechanism of action involves gradual up-dosing to increase immune tolerance to the relevant grass pollens, leading to immunomodulation characterized by reduced recruitment of T-lymphocytes and eosinophils, a shift from Th2 to Th1 cytokine production, increased IL-10 synthesis causing T-cell anergy, and decreased histamine release from basophils. This results in suppression of allergic responses upon subsequent exposure to the allergens[6][7][8][10]. Developed for long-term disease-modifying therapy under medical supervision.
